Nestled in the rugged terrain near Crossville, Tennessee, Black Mountain stands as a beacon for climbing enthusiasts seeking a top roping adventure. This area, located approximately an hour and a half west of Knoxville, offers a rich tapestry of climbing routes that cater to both novice and experienced climbers. Here's your guide to making the most of your visit to Black Mountain, including interesting facts, history, and local knowledge that every visitor should know.
Black Mountain is not only a climbing haven but also a place steeped in natural beauty and geological wonder. Its elevation and unique rock formations make it an ideal spot for top roping—a style of climbing where the rope is anchored at the top of the route, providing safety for the climber as they ascend.
To reach Black Mountain from Knoxville, take I-40 West towards Crossville. After approximately an hour's drive, take exit 322 and follow the signs towards Crossville. From there, local signage will guide you towards Black Mountain's climbing areas. Expect a journey of around 1.5 hours, depending on traffic and weather conditions.
